Job Summary

We are seeking an experienced and respected aviation leader to provide operational leadership for a fleet of Bell 412 helicopters operating in support of Quebecs provincial air ambulance program. This role is responsible for pilot oversight standardization training leadership and day-to-day operational excellence within a demanding safety-critical environment.

The successful candidate will act as the senior professional authority for flight crews ensuring consistent operational standards strong safety culture and effective coordination with clinical partners and operational leadership.

Qualifications & Experience

  • Airline Transport Pilot License (Helicopter) ATPL(H)

  • 2500 flight hours as a turbine helicopter pilot including 1000 hours as pilotincommand of which 500 hours are on a mediumcategory helicopter

  • Instrument flight rating (Group 4) and two (2) years of experience in instrument flight operations;

  • Night flight rating

  • Advanced NVIS qualification with a minimum of 50 flight hours using NVIS and NVG

  • Category 1 medical certificate

  • Extensive operational experience on medium twin-engine helicopters (Bell 412 strongly preferred with Bell 412 type rating )

  • Strong background in EMS / air ambulance IFR and multi-crew operations

  • Demonstrated leadership experience in a senior pilot training or fleet oversight role

  • Respected professional judgement with the ability to lead by influence and example

  • Excellent communication skills in operational and crew-facing environments

  • Ability to work effectively in a bilingual (French/English) operational setting

  • Authorization to work in Canada & travel to the USA for training

  • Able to pass a Criminal Background Check related to access to Controlled Goods (NVGs)
